Now, I would say that I've been role-playing for quite some time now, mostly on LOTRO (Lord of the rings online), and it's great there, I found it easy to get into role-play because there aren't gaps that need filling when it comes to lore or anything. But with TESO, I found there's /many/ gaps.
I've searched on TESO-RP.com, and the forums here, and none of them seem to answer the types of questions you /need/ to begin role-play, such as;

1. Who can talk with who? Bretons, Nords, Elves.
2. Who hates who? Who has a long running pact (this would help answer the first question) of hate between each-other, so that they can't talk or interact?
3. If you're making an elf, or a breton, or any race; what's a suitable name for them? Do they have to be fantasy-type names, or can they be normal?
4. Where is the most role-play found on the game?
5. What kind of jobs can you say that you have, and not sound ridiculous? Can you be a member of the royal guard, or do you have to have a simple job like a farmer?
6. Where are the different races most likely born? If someone doesn't know they, they could say they were from somewhere ridiculous and people in OOC will shout at them.
7. If you're from a certain place in Tamriel, like let's say Auridon, is there anywhere where you /wouldn't/ go at all? Is there somewhere, where if you someone asked you where you were from and you said; "Auridon." Would it be ridiculous that you would ever be in this place?

There are basic questions that I feel have been completely left out, and beginner role-players on this server (like me) who know nothing of lore need to know them.

    1. I'm not sure what you mean. Most races have their own language, but they all can learn and speak the common tongue. Oh well, except the quadruped Khajiits; they can understand, but can't talk common language (but they can speak to other Khajiits).
    2. They all hate each other, seriously. Even in the same "alliance" they are like dog and cat. You can easily see Dark Elf racist toward Agronian, Argonian call other mammal races "milk sucker"... ect...
    3. Some races have meaning names which can linked to real life name/language, some are just random, like Khajiit. Can't talk about this in 1 post. You should google for more infor.
    4. No particular place. Find your rp partner/group/guild (http://teso-rp.com/forum) and just do it anywhere you like (but beware the trolls, they always begging for feeding, so just don't feed them).
    5. You can be anyone. But be careful when claiming yourself a noble man or a too powerful character, it's a touchy touchy thing many people don't want to deal with.
    6. Google. Note that slavery is just ended in Tamriel not too long ago, so many people could be born far from their homeland. Many travelers or mage/fighter guild members also travel around the world and can stay wherever they want so it's not restrictive where you're come from by your race.
    7. Again, google. I think you can come from anywhere in Tamriel, but say you're from Akavir or Yokuda is a bit... exaggeration.

    I would whole heartedly recommend the shoddycast Elderscrolls lore series(Can be found on youtube), it's short videos on given Aedra and Daedra (Gods and Demons of ES.) cultures, races, historical events and genuinely everything you'll need to know about Tamriel, bare In mind however that ESO is set within The Second Era so some events that have occurred don't actively affect what's going on in say the single player Oblivion and Skyrim, vice versa too.

    Tiber Septim (Talos) is a good example of this, in ESO he hasn't been born yet and currently they're only 8 divines (if I'm right.)
